Keary Colbert



Patrick Keary Jerel Colbert (born May 21, 1982 in Oxnard, California, United States) is an American football player.

Professional Career

He was the Carolina Panthers' second round pick in the 2004 NFL Draft. On the Panthers, Keary stepped into the 2nd receiver spot when Steve Smith was injured. He filled in nicely, catching 47 catches for 754 yards and 5 touchdowns. With high expectations for Keary in the 2005 season, he struggled catching 25 passes for 282 yards and just 2 touchdowns.

College Career

He attended University of Southern California, where he was a star wide receiver. In his final year at USC, Colbert made an unbelievable catch while he was interfered by two defenders in the Rose Bowl against University of Michigan, broke away and walked into the end zone for a touchdown. Colbert's 149 yards in the Rose Bowl were a career high. Colbert left USC as the school's all-time leader in pass receptions, passing Kareem Kelly with 207.

He has caught at least one pass in his final 36 games. He earned All-Pac 10 second-team honors his senior year and finished second on the team with 69 receptions for 1,013 yards and nine touchdowns.
